The base fabric is an Organic Cotton Poplin - Verona, which has a soft appearance and a stiff feel, with a weight of 110 gr/m2 and a composition of 100% organic cotton. It is sustainable and GOTS certified (ORGANIC CU1016503). The printing technology used is REACTIVE DIGITAL DIRECT (NATURAL FIBERS), which allows the printed design to fully adhere to the fabric and maintain its quality and coloration over time. The paint-like design, of very simple complexity and a drawn and decorative style, has multicolor as its main colors, giving it a youthful and fresh touch. It can be combined with other plain colors that complement the designs tones, such as white, blue, or green. The fabric is digitally printed on one side only.
Regarding its characteristics, the fabric is suitable for use in summer garments for both women and men, in shirts, dresses, blouses, and childrens wear. Its softness to the touch makes it pleasant for everyday use, while its stiffness allows garments to maintain their shape and structure. The printed design, thanks to its simplicity and decorative style, is suitable for youthful and fresh garments.
As for care, for maintenance, it is advisable not to bleach, wash at a maximum temperature of 30ºC, iron at a cool temperature, dry clean except for trichloroethylene, and tumble dry at a reduced temperature.
Finally, REACTIVE DIGITAL DIRECT printing technology involves the direct application of the printed design onto the fabric, allowing for high resolution and definition. Furthermore, being an environmentally friendly process, it contributes to the sustainability and high quality of the fabric.
